BMA guidance suggest a safe number of appointments that GP's and other clinicians should see patients in each day. Most days, our GP's and other clinicians are seeing above the BMA guidance due to demand, on top of all other background processes and work. When we are at full capacity, this means that the GP's and other clinicians have no other space to book any appointments in and doing so could be clinically unsafe. Whilst a member of our team may have said that the lines were steady, they cannot see how many patients are queueing and if there has been a patient with a complex call that has taken some time. Our call centre and triage team work hard and efficiently to try and deal with queries in the quickest and safest manner to enable patients to navigate our system better, but unfortunately we cannot control how many patients are calling the surgery. The issues that you have mentioned are that of a wider NHS. Ultimately, many practices are struggling to meet the demand for patients which is why other options outside of the practice are becoming more regularly available. Inspire Health, as with many other practices, have adopted a 'total triage' stance with appointments. This means that all clinical appointment requests are screened and triaged by a GP to offer an appropriate appointment or sign-post to a more suitable service. It is not simply true that the practice offers only 'same-day' appointments and I can confirm that the practice offers both urgent on the day appointments as well as more routine based appointments that are booked in advance. All requests are triaged regardless of urgency and this is to ensure patient safety. Your comments are concerning and wonder if there is more to this matter than your comments suggest.
